3 right of substitution
право замены ( ценных бумаг, обеспечения), право на заменуrepo право участника сделки РЕПО, поставившего ценные бумаги, осуществить замену данных ценных бумаг другими (эквивалентными) ценными бумагами в течение срока сделки РЕПОАнгло-русский словарь терминов по депозитарному хранению и клирингу > right of substitution
